SEAT BELT RETRACTOR WITH A VELOCITY-CONTROLLED LOAD LIMITING DEVICE
20170182973 · 2017-06-29 ·

A seat belt retractor includes a belt shaft pivot-mounted in a retractor frame, wherein the belt shaft shows an at least two-part design with a first and a second part. A load limiting device includes at least two parts, which can be moved relative to each other and have teeth, with which they alternately engage and disengage. Each of the parts of the load limiting device is allocated to a different part of the belt shaft. A tensioning device is located on the second part of the belt shaft and, upon activation, abruptly drives the belt shaft in the winding direction. One of the parts of the load limiting device, via a transmission device, is connected in a rotationally-fixed manner to the second part of the belt shaft through the first part, which is a hollow shaft.

Webbing take-up device

A webbing take-up device including: a spool on which a webbing fitted over an occupant is taken up; a restricting member restricting a rotation of the spool in the pullout direction under specific circumstances; a force limiter mechanism permitting the rotation of the spool in the pullout direction when a force limiter load or a higher load is imparted while the restricting member is restricting the rotation of the spool in the pullout direction; a switching member being capable of switching between a disposed position at a first position and a disposed position at second position, and provided between the first position and the second position; and an operation member being capable of being switched between operation and non-operation, whereby the disposed position of the switching member is switched between the first position and the second position and the force limiter load is switched between a high-load and a low-load.

BELT RETRACTOR FOR A SEATBELT DEVICE OF A MOTOR VEHICLE
20250065839 · 2025-02-27 ·

The invention relates to a belt retractor for a seatbelt device of a motor vehicle, having a belt shaft, rotatably mounted in a frame, for winding up a seatbelt of the seatbelt device, wherein the frame has two opposing wall sections oriented in parallel with one another and each having a bearing opening, in which wall sections the belt shaft is rotatably mounted, and a spring housing secured to one of the wall sections and having a return spring arranged therein, which is connected to the spring housing at a first end and rotationally fixed to the belt shaft at a second end, wherein the spring housing is radially elastically retained on the wall section.

Load-limiting seatbelt retractor

A restraint system includes a retractor housing; a spool rotatably coupled to the retractor housing and defining an axis of rotation; an inner torsion bar elongated along the axis of rotation and positioned coaxially in the spool; an outer torsion bar elongated along the axis of rotation, extending coaxially around the inner torsion bar, and positioned coaxially in the spool; an engagement member selectively engageable with the outer torsion bar; and a solenoid operable to move the engagement member into engagement with the outer torsion bar and out of engagement with the outer torsion bar.

Belt retractor for a vehicle safety belt

A belt retractor comprising a safety belt reel (1) rotatably mounted on a frame (7) and a load limiter (2) which acts on a rotational movement of the belt reel (1) and has a switchable energy consumption, said load limiter having a granulate (3), which is enclosed in a closed load limiter chamber (8) and consists of dry, granular solid, and at least one rotating member (4) which can be rotated relative to the granulate (3), the energy consumption resulting from shear forces acts between the grains of granulate.

SEAT BELT RETRACTOR AND SEAT BELT DEVICE
20170129452 · 2017-05-11 · ·

Provided are a seat belt retractor and a seat belt device with which it is possible to improve energy absorption characteristics and a restraining property. The seat belt retractor includes a spool that performs winding of a webbing for restraining an occupant, a shaft inserted through an axial center of the spool, and a locking base connected to the shaft and capable of switching between a rotating state and a non-rotating state. The seat belt retractor further includes a load adjustment member disposed between the shaft and the locking base and that blocks or reduces load transmission in a case where a load equal to or greater than a threshold is applied to the shaft, and an energy absorption device disposed between the spool and the locking base and capable of changing an energy absorption amount according to a relative rotation speed between the spool and the locking base. The energy absorption device is connected in parallel with the load adjustment member.

Webbing take-up device

In a pretensioner mechanism of a webbing take-up device, a sealing member seals a communicating hole of a piston. When a force limiter mechanism is operated and rotating of a spool in a pull-out direction is allowed, the piston is moved to an upper side in a state in which the sealing member is pressed and contacted against a cylinder. As a result, the sealing member is turned and the sealing of the communicating hole by the sealing member is released. In consequence, a number of components may be reduced and assembly characteristics of the pretensioner mechanism may be improved.
